Grum get a Car Laptop adapter to power the actual laptop it's basiclly the same brick you use to power your laptop inside but it connects to the cig socket.

Also i would see if I could find a Docking station for the laptop so you can power it on and off and you can slot the laptop out when you want and slot it back in

And you won't have to reconnect the usb plugs etc if you get a docking station.

I gather your gonna make the laptop shutdown when it runs on it's own battery?

Alot of people mount their laptops under their seats and use velcro strips to hold it there and they haven't had any problems at all

For Volume control you can actually make a small knob which connects between the laptop and the headunit to control it
